Our Mission: To invite adults who are at least 55
to use their life experience, wisdom, and skills
to answer the call of their neighbors in need,
and in doing so, improve the quality of life for
both volunteer and community.
History: RSVP has been evolving for 34 years to meet America's needs. Passed in Congress in 1969 with the Older American's Act, RSVP was established in 1971 to create volunteer opportunities for the senior population, and to be a resource to address community needs. As a locally directed, but federally legislated grant program, RSVP's focus is helping these Americans to find ways to help their communities. Weld County RSVP is locally sponsored by the University of Northern Colorado in Greeley.
Service: RSVP recruits and interviews interested volunteers, matching their skills, talents, interests, and time availability to appropriate volunteer assignments. Weld County RSVP has agreements with multiple not-for-profit agencies and civic agencies where volunteers can contribute their time and talents. RSVP also works with organizations to identify meaningful volunteer opportunities in response to specific community needs.
Weld County RSVP manages 6 community service programs that are supported by RSVP Volunteers.
